Javascript Can';t解析'/node_modules/bootstrap/dist/css/bootstrap.min.css';?

Javascript Can';t解析'/node_modules/bootstrap/dist/css/bootstrap.min.css';?,javascript,reactjs,bootstrap-4,Javascript,Reactjs,Bootstrap 4,我试图在我的项目中使用react-bootstrap-table2创建一个简单的引导表,但出现错误: 未能编译:未找到模块:无法在“/Users/xxx/Documents/xxx/src/routes/home”中解析“../node\u modules/bootstrap/dist/css/bootstrap.min.css” 我确实安装了所有必要的软件包,并验证了bootstrap.min.css存在于它应该存在的地方 我的代码如下所示: import React from 'react'

我试图在我的项目中使用react-bootstrap-table2创建一个简单的引导表,但出现错误:

未能编译:未找到模块:无法在“/Users/xxx/Documents/xxx/src/routes/home”中解析“../node\u modules/bootstrap/dist/css/bootstrap.min.css”

我确实安装了所有必要的软件包,并验证了bootstrap.min.css存在于它应该存在的地方

我的代码如下所示:

import React from 'react';
import '../node_modules/bootstrap/dist/css/bootstrap.min.css'; 
import BootstrapTable from 'react-bootstrap-table-next';

class Home extends React.Component {
  state = {
    products: [
      {
        id: 1,
        name: 'TV',
        'price': 1000
      },
      {
        id: 2,
        name: 'Mobile',
        'price': 500
      },
      {
        id: 3,
        name: 'Book',
        'price': 20
      },
    ],
    columns: [{
      dataField: 'id',
      text: 'Product ID'
    },
    {
      dataField: 'name',
      text: 'Product Name'
    }, {
      dataField: 'price',
      text: 'Product Price',
      sort: true
    }]
  } 

  render() {
    return (
      <div className="container" style={{ marginTop: 50 }}>
        <BootstrapTable 
        striped
        hover
        keyField='id' 
        data={ this.state.products } 
        columns={ this.state.columns } />
      </div>
    );
  }
}

export default Home;
有没有关于如何解决该错误的建议?

试试以下方法:

import 'bootstrap/dist/css/bootstrap.min.css';

未指定路径时,节点/网页包将在
节点\u模块
文件夹中搜索导入。我不确定出了什么问题,但这是从
node\u modules
文件夹导入模块的正确方法。

node\u modules中的目录不需要路径前缀。这解决了问题,谢谢!只要Stack允许,我就会接受。这行应该怎么做?当我尝试导入font-awesome@import'font-awesome/css/font-awesome.min.css'时,这个解决方案也对我有效;
import 'bootstrap/dist/css/bootstrap.min.css';